Standard Setting: If you adopt below DRAM / CPU configuration on this motherboard, you need to adjust the jumpers. Please follow the instructions below to set up the jumpers. Otherwise, the CPU and memory module may not work properly on this motherboard. Please use jumper to force NB to be strapped at higher frequency, so the DRAM can work at lower frequency. If you want to overclock the CPU you adopt to FSB1066 on this motherboard, you need to adjust the jumpers. Please short pin4, pin5 for FSB2 jumper and pin4, pin5 for FSB3 jumper. Otherwise, the CPU may not work properly on this motherboard. Please refer to below jumper settings. 4_5 FSB3 FSB2 4_5 1_2 FSB1 If you want to overclock the CPU you adopt to FSB1333 on this motherboard, you need to adjust the jumpers. Please short pin3, pin4 for FSB2 jumper and pin4, pin5 for FSB3 jumper. Otherwise, the CPU may not work properly on this motherboard.
